Nicely done. $20K off MSRP is very doable at this point, aside from what narrative some dealers and people try to paint. Just need to look around and start making offers. The .2 will be a year old soon.
At the end of the day, dealers want to sell cars. They don't make money by letting them sit there at over inflated prices. Most dealers aren't the super high volume ones you always hear about. The other 80% have to work at selling cars and are willing to wheel and deal.
For current owners, try and trade one back in. See how high the price is there The dealer story will be a different narrative there.

My 17 C2S CPO was almost exactly 20k off MSRP and I also got close to what I paid from my 14 C2S CPO as a trade in value. My salesman said the reason the 17 I bought had sat was because it did not have a sunroof or the 14/18 adjust seats. Neither of those options mattered to me. Mine has the 4 way sport seats which are surprisingly comfortable.
Only had 700 miles on it when I drove it home. So I feel like I did pretty well on this particular deal and the car was almost exactly what I would have ordered had I spec'd it.

STG -- thanks for some great threads. I was following the 991 HFS thread for ~ 5 months looking for the right match. Kept coming up short. Started reading more about the 991.2.
Coming from an '08 Audi A4 I figured I wouldn't miss out on the reported shortcomings: turbos vs NA and tamer exhaust note. Greater torque at low RPM and more usable power for DD seemed like a good trade-off.
I found a 2017 C2 manual cab, PSE, Bose, entry and drive with 1,700 miles. Essentially new.
Kevin at Beachwood Porsche was great.
I put 19in snow wheels/tires on prior to delivery. Saving the 20 Carerra S wheels for April.
This car is so much better than the base 991 that I have test-driven. I love this car!!
